When I hide a window it take some time for it to be hidden completely (from the taskbar) because of the default hiding animation. By try and error I found out that takes about 250-260ms (on Windows 8.1).

For my application I have to know the exact time it takes because it's probably different on each Windows version and I guess the user can disable it too. Do you know a way to find out if the window animations are enabled and if so how long they take?

It would be even better if I would be able to hide my window immediately, no matter if the user has the animation enabled or not. A trick I'm currently using is to move the window off the screen. That's working fine for the window itself, however the window's tab on the taskbar still animates. Unfortunately even ITaskBarList\DeleteTab() makes no difference. Any suggestions?

Thanks Rashad, this allows me to find out if the animation is enabled. Strange though that ANIMATIONINFO doesn't say how long it takes. Any ideas for that?

By the way, your code disabled the window animation. I also found the following solution:

Code: Select all

HRESULT DisableDwmAnimations(HWND hwnd)
{
    BOOL fDisable = TRUE;
    return DwmSetWindowAttribute(hwnd,
                DWMWA_TRANSITIONS_FORCEDISABLED,
                &fDisable,
                sizeof(fDisable));
}
Unfortunately your code and that one above didn't affect the animation on the taskbar... :(

Using DWMWA as you mentioned

Code: Select all

#DWMWA_TRANSITIONS_FORCEDISABLED = 3

OpenWindow(0, 0, 0, 300, 300, "Window TRANSITIONS Test", #PB_Window_SystemMenu | #PB_Window_ScreenCentered | #PB_Window_MaximizeGadget | #PB_Window_MinimizeGadget)

ButtonGadget(0, 5, 5, 64, 24, "TEST")

Repeat
   Event = WaitWindowEvent()
   
   Select Event
      Case #PB_Event_Gadget
         Select EventGadget()
            Case 0
               Disable = 1
               If OpenLibrary(0, "dwmapi.dll")      
                    CallFunction(0, "DwmSetWindowAttribute", WindowID(0), #DWMWA_TRANSITIONS_FORCEDISABLED, @Disable, SizeOf(Long))      
                    CloseLibrary(0)
              EndIf
              HideWindow(0,1)
         EndSelect
   EndSelect
   
Until Event = #PB_Event_CloseWindow
